- thatoneprogrammer asdfJan 16, 2024 · 2 years agoCryptocurrency prices fluctuate due to various market factors, such as supply and demand, market sentiment, regulatory changes, and technological advancements. When there is high demand for a particular cryptocurrency and limited supply, its price tends to increase. Conversely, if there is low demand or an oversupply, the price may decrease. Market sentiment, influenced by news, events, and investor sentiment, also plays a significant role in price fluctuations. Additionally, regulatory changes, such as government regulations or bans, can impact cryptocurrency prices. Technological advancements, such as the development of new blockchain solutions or improvements in security, can also affect prices. Overall, cryptocurrency price fluctuations are a result of the complex interplay between these factors.

- Hugo MolanderJan 14, 2024 · 2 years agoCryptocurrency prices are highly volatile and can fluctuate dramatically. Several factors contribute to these fluctuations. Supply and demand dynamics play a significant role. When there is a high demand for a cryptocurrency and limited supply, its price tends to rise. Conversely, if there is low demand or an oversupply, the price may drop. Market sentiment also influences prices. Positive news, such as the integration of cryptocurrencies into mainstream financial systems, can boost prices, while negative news, such as security breaches or regulatory restrictions, can cause prices to decline. Additionally, technological advancements and innovations in the cryptocurrency industry can impact prices. For example, the development of faster and more scalable blockchain solutions can increase investor confidence and drive prices up. It's important to note that cryptocurrency prices are also influenced by external factors, such as global economic conditions and geopolitical events. Therefore, it's crucial for investors to stay informed and analyze multiple factors when assessing cryptocurrency price fluctuations.
